Transaction 64a2829f4af2c4162add1275e97b189778cd185246f855244333cdf013b422fa

1 Input
2 Outputs
  • 64a2829f4af2c4162add1275e97b189778cd185246f855244333cdf013b422fa:0
  • value  540298
    address  177oegdekoubd3VY8QtU5KWJVHitFhxPjH
  • 64a2829f4af2c4162add1275e97b189778cd185246f855244333cdf013b422fa:1
  • value  103889967
    address  12ZKAKZgFRZoHoVLyPtQyiD62Yath27gsS